Coming Home was written by Ed Roland when he was inspired while traveling through the Hartsfield-Jackson Atlanta International Airport and seeing the USO representatives there to welcome home the men and women of the armed forces. It's a very moving song and a heartfelt tribute to our brave soldiers. Ed Roland and the Sweet Tea Project's Advanced Live Performance of their up coming release Alder Lane Farm, their second album, from Eddie's Attic in Decatur, GA on Wednesday, June 22, 2016. They first performed the 10 songs from the new album and then performed two songs from their first album, Devils 'n Darlins (Forget About Your Life and Devils 'n Darlins), a cover of Johnny Cash's Folsom Prison Blues and the great Collective Soul hit The World I know. An encore included Just As I Am from Devils 'n Darlins and finally concluding the evening with Collective Soul's staple Shine. Sadly, the encore songs were not recorded because by battery died. These are not the best quality recordings, but nonetheless, are a decent preview of the new music that should be available late this year.
